D.K. Metcalf Injury History

Date League Injury Games Missed Details
Oct 20, 2024
NFL Knee MCL Pull
Grade 1
2 Metcalf sustained a knee injury during Week 7's game in Atlanta.
Oct 18, 2023
NFL Chest Rib Bruise
Grade 1
1 Metcalf was inactive for Week 7's game versus the Cardinals due to a rib injury.
Oct 23, 2022
NFL Knee Patella Sprain
Grade 1
- Metcalf landed awkwardly on his left knee.
Sep 30, 2021
NFL Pedal Foot Unspecified
Grade 1
- Metcalf appeared to the Seahawks' Week 4 report injury due to a foot issue. He was bothered by a foot ailment all season.
Aug 18, 2019
NFL Knee Unspecified Strain
Grade 1
- Metcalf injured his knee during the 2019 pre-season.
Aug 3, 2019
NFL Abdomen Muscle Sprain/Pull
Unspecified Grade 1
- Metcalf dealt with a minor oblique injury during the 2019 pre-season
Oct 13, 2018
Non-NFL Cervical Neck Fracture
Grade 1
5 Neck injury in 2018 that ended his season in week 7 against Arkansas.
Sep 10, 2016
Non-NFL Pedal Foot Fracture
Grade 1
10 Broke his foot against Ole Miss and missed rest of season. Not much more info disclosed.

Geno Smith's Knee "Structurally" OK

Seahawks HC Mike Macdonald said after Sunday night's loss to the Packers that QB Geno Smith's right knee is "structurally" ok. "(It was) severe enough for him not to come back in the game," Macdonald added. "We'll do all the tests tomorrow and kind of figure it out as we go. ... I know we'll do everything humanely possible to go play, but just don't know right now." We should get another update by the end of today, but it sounds more likely than not that Smith misses time. That'd leave Sam Howell under center. He struggled badly in relief of Smith against Green Bay, completing just 5 of 14 passes for 24 yards and an INT. Howell was a mixed bag as Washington's starter last year, throwing for 3,946 yards and 21 TDs but also tossing 21 INTs and taking 65 sacks. He's a clear downgrade from Smith -- but better than most backups in the league.

Seahawks WR D.K. Metcalf is considered "week to week" with a Grade 1 MCL sprain suffered in the Week 7 win over the Falcons, according to ESPN's Adam Schefter. Seattle gets the Bills and Rams the next two weeks before a Week 10 bye, so it's possible we don't see Metcalf again until Week 11.
